The proliferation of user-generated content (UGC) continues to challenge traditional news verification processes, forcing media organizations to rethink their editorial safeguards. As events unfold globally, citizen journalism provides an immediate, unfiltered look at crises, but separating fact from fabrication has become a critical, complex endeavor. How can newsrooms reliably verify UGC while maintaining the speed and relevance demanded by a 24/7 news cycle?
Key Takeaways
- Implement multi-source verification protocols for all UGC, cross-referencing with satellite imagery and local contacts.
- Invest in AI-driven tools for initial content analysis, but always pair with human expertise for final authentication.
- Establish clear, publicly accessible editorial guidelines for UGC integration, promoting transparency with your audience.
- Train journalists rigorously in open-source intelligence (OSINT) techniques to identify deepfakes and manipulated media.
- Develop partnerships with local fact-checking organizations to enhance verification capabilities in conflict zones.

Implications: Erosion of Trust and Operational Challenges
The primary implication of poorly verified UGC is a catastrophic erosion of public trust. When news organizations publish inaccurate information, even inadvertently, they chip away at their own credibility. This isn’t just an abstract concept; it has real-world consequences. During periods of crisis, accurate information is vital for public safety and informed decision-making. Misinformation, amplified by unverified UGC, can lead to panic, misdirected aid, or even exacerbate conflict. We saw this during the recent geopolitical tensions in the South China Sea, where viral videos purportedly showing naval clashes turned out to be old footage from military exercises, causing unnecessary alarm.
Operationally, the challenge for newsrooms is immense. Dedicated content verification teams are now essential, but they require specialized skills in open-source intelligence (OSINT), digital forensics, and regional expertise. Tools like Storyful and Bellingcat’s methodologies are becoming standard, but they demand significant training and resources. I’ve always maintained that simply having the tools isn’t enough; you need the critical thinking and journalistic skepticism to wield them effectively. It’s a constant battle against a tide of digital noise, and frankly, some newsrooms are just not prepared for it. They’re still operating on verification models from a decade ago, which simply won’t cut it in 2026 journalism.
What’s Next: A Future of Collaborative Verification and AI-Assisted Fact-Checking
The path forward involves a multi-pronged approach: advanced technology, rigorous training, and unprecedented collaboration. News organizations must invest in AI-powered verification tools that can quickly analyze metadata, perform reverse image searches, and detect anomalies in video and audio. However, and this is critical, these tools are aids, not replacements for human judgment. We must pair them with highly skilled journalists who understand the nuances of context, culture, and conflict. The human element, the journalist’s nose for a story and their inherent skepticism, remains irreplaceable.
Furthermore, I believe we’ll see a significant increase in collaborative verification efforts. Partnerships between news organizations, academic institutions, and independent fact-checking groups will become the norm. Imagine a global consortium sharing verified content and flagging potential disinformation in real-time. The Reuters Institute for the Study of Journalism has been advocating for such models, emphasizing the need for shared databases of known fakes and deepfake detection signatures. It’s a collective defense against a collective threat. We must also be more transparent with our audiences about our verification processes. Clearly labeling content as “unverified” or “currently under review” can manage expectations and build trust even when we can’t immediately confirm every detail. This level of transparency might feel counterintuitive for some traditionalists, but it’s the only way to genuinely connect with an increasingly skeptical public.

What is user-generated content (UGC) in journalism?
UGC in journalism refers to any content (photos, videos, text, audio) created and shared by the public, rather than by professional journalists. It often provides raw, immediate perspectives from event locations.
Why is content verification challenging for newsrooms in 2026?
Verification is challenging due to the sheer volume of UGC, the speed at which it spreads, and the sophistication of deepfake and AI manipulation tools that make fabricated content highly realistic.
What is open-source intelligence (OSINT) and how does it relate to UGC verification?
OSINT involves collecting and analyzing publicly available information. In UGC verification, it’s used to cross-reference details, geolocate content, identify sources, and detect manipulation using tools and public databases.
How can news organizations build trust when using UGC?
News organizations can build trust by implementing transparent verification processes, clearly labeling content as unverified when necessary, and investing in rigorous fact-checking and journalist training.
Are AI tools sufficient for verifying UGC?
No, AI tools are powerful aids for initial analysis and detection of anomalies, but they are not sufficient on their own. Human judgment, critical thinking, and journalistic expertise are essential for contextualizing and definitively verifying UGC.
